Explain with suitable reason WebThe chemical equation of this process is as follow: 2NaCl (aq) + 2H₂O (1) →2NaOH (aq) + Cl₂ (g) + H₂ (g) When electricity is passed through an aqueous solution of sodium chloride (called brine), Chlorine gas is given off at the anode, and hydrogen gas at the cathode. Sodium hydroxide solution is formed near the cathode. The chloralkali process (also chlor-alkali and chlor alkali) is an industrial process for the electrolysis of sodium chloride (NaCl) solutions. It is the technology used to produce chlorine and sodium hydroxide (caustic soda), which are commodity chemicals required by industry. WebVerified by Toppr. The Chlor-alkali process is used in the electrolysis of NaCl. The important products formed in this process are sodium hydroxide, chlorine, and hydrogen gas. 2NaCl+2H 2O 2NaOH+Cl 2+H 2. An electric current is passed through the brine to form H 2 at the cathode and Cl 2 at the anode, leaving a solution of sodium hydroxide.
